Meta’s Threads Hits 300 Million Users, Zuckerberg Lauds ‘Strong Momentum’

Meta’s Threads app has now hit a major milestone of 300 million users with over 100 million people using the platform every day. Mark Zuckerberg shared the news in a post on Threads, saying, “Threads strong momentum continues.”

Zuckerberg has previously said that Threads has a “good chance” of becoming Meta’s next billion-user app. “I thought for a long time, there should be a billion-person public conversations app that is a bit more positive and I think that if we keep at this for a few more years, then I think we have a good chance of achieving our vision there,” Zuckerberg said during the company’s third-quarter earnings call.

While it’s still a long way from that goal, the app’s growth is clearly speeding up. Threads reached 100 million users last fall and hit 275 million in early November, according to head of Instagram and supporter of Threads, Adam Mosseri.

Meanwhile, Apple revealed that Threads was the second-most downloaded app in 2024 with shopping app Temu taking the top spot.

Apple’s App Store Awards shows Meta’s Threads at second position in the list of most-download Apps of 2024.

The next few weeks could bring some big changes as Meta looks to build on this momentum. According to a recent report by The Information, Meta plans to test ads on Threads starting in early 2025.

Threads isn’t the only platform vying to be the new “public square” as some users move away from X (formerly Twitter). Another app, Bluesky has also grown significantly nearly doubling its user base in November to reach just over 25 million users. However, Bluesky hasn’t revealed how many of its users are active daily.

While Threads is much larger, it seems Meta is paying attention to Bluesky’s features. Recently, Threads rolled out updates inspired by Bluesky’s custom feeds and starter packs, which let users personalize their content experience.

With its rapid growth and upcoming features, Threads is shaping up to be a strong competitor in the social media space.
